Details
Avoid unreferenced Functions (metric id 7860) This unified rule reports unreferenced artifacts on more than 50 objects types.including database (all supported RDBMS) functions and procedures.
To enable this rule for the T-SQL technology we need to add the techno-filter in the assessment model in CAST-MS
Open CAST-MS
Open Assessment Model
Goto “Quality Rules” tab and open the rule “Avoid unreferenced Functions”
Goto Compute settings tab and find the list of supported technologies in the bottom pane.
Add the technology to the list.
